Playing back from the text memo position
1
Press the <THUMBNAIL> button.
The thumbnail screen appears on the viewfinder screen.
2
Press the <THUMBNAIL MENU> button and select
[THUMBNAIL]
[TEXT MEMO CLIPS] from the thumbnail
menu.
The clip thumbnails with text memos attached are displayed in the
upper section of the viewfinder screen. The lower section of the
viewfinder screen shows information about the text memo on the clip
selected by the pointer.

3
Move the pointer over the clip that contains the desired text
memo to play back and press the <SET> button.
The pointer moves to the lower part of the viewfinder screen.

4
With the pointer located in the lower part, move the pointer
to the desired text memo number using the cursor right and
left buttons (
Y
/
I
), then press the <PLAY/PAUSE> button.
f
Playback will start from the time code position of the text memo
where the pointer is located.
If the <STOP> button is pressed during playback or the playback
has finished at the end of the clip, then the thumbnail screen
appears again with the pointer placed on the thumbnail of the text
memo where the playback started.

Deleting text memos
1
Perform steps 1
to
3 in “Playing back from the text memo
position” (page 108) to select the desired text memo in a
clip.
2
Move the pointer to the text memo to be deleted and press
the <SET> button.
3
Press the <THUMBNAIL MENU> button, and select
[OPERATION]
[DELETE] from the menu.
When [YES] and [NO] appear to confirm deletion, select [YES] using
the cursor buttons and the <SET> button to delete the text memo.
